Output 9186e1366a0b943fbc3761bae4288f15a2f9b955c6581ff22fb895b4946e6ee9:0

value
1058936
script pubkey
OP_0 OP_PUSHBYTES_20 35178522fe759e43e33c73ddab7cca7a36655dcc
address
bc1qx5tc2gh7wk0y8ceuw0w6klx20gmx2hwvfeemsj
transaction
9186e1366a0b943fbc3761bae4288f15a2f9b955c6581ff22fb895b4946e6ee9
confirmations
52385
spent
true